1. Industrial Campus Backbone & Segmented Automation Networks
In multi-building manufacturing plants, networks must handle separate office, operational technology (OT), and security camera subnets. The TL-SG5452, with L3 static routing and RIP protocols, enables local routing between subnets directly on the switch itself, reducing bottlenecking on the core gateway.
Problem SolvedEliminates network congestion caused by inter-VLAN routing having to travel all the way up to a centralized firewalled router (router-on-a-stick topology), while keeping high-speed local data transfer.

2. Distributed IP Video Surveillance Aggregation
Large-scale industrial facilities deploy dozens of security cameras across wide areas. The TL-SG5452 features 48 Gigabit ports and 4 independent SFP slots, making it perfect as an aggregation switch. It uses IGMP Snooping (v1/v2/v3) and L2-L4 QoS to optimize multicast IP video feeds, ensuring zero packet loss and low latency.
Problem SolvedPrevents multicast storm flooding across unrelated network segments, which degrades control system communication, and prioritizes critical camera video feeds over general traffic.

3. Secured Edge Device Access in Smart Warehouses
Smart warehouses utilize multiple network-enabled IoT gateways, PLCs, and barcode scanner terminals. Implementing the TL-SG5452 at the edge provides enhanced local cybersecurity through IP-MAC-Port-VID binding and 802.1X authentication, ensuring only authorized devices connect to the OT infrastructure.
Problem SolvedMitigates rogue hardware attachment and malicious ARP spoofing or DoS attacks at remote edge nodes, maintaining uninterrupted warehouse material handling operations.
